• If you’re planning a trip to the Indiana Dunes National Park, you’ll want to know where to eat after a day of hiking the dunes, exploring the beach, or strolling downtown. Luckily, Chesterton, Indiana has an incredible food scene that surprises many first-time visitors. From cozy Italian cafés to eclectic burger joints, here are some of the best restaurants near the Indiana Dunes to add to your list.

    Joe’s Bread – Coffee & Healthy Bites in Chesterton

    For your morning fuel, Joe’s Bread is a must. This coffee shop is known for its wholesome ingredients and baked goods that taste as good as they look. They proudly serve coffee sourced from local roasters, and the menu leans toward the fresh, healthy side…think flavorful sandwiches, pastries, and breakfast staples that are anything but ordinary. It’s the perfect place to start your day in Chesterton before heading out to the Indiana Dunes trails.

    Red Cup Café – Local Art & the Best Egg Sandwich in Town

    Right in the heart of downtown Chesterton, across from the charming town gazebo, you’ll find Red Cup Café…a colorful, welcoming spot that feels like the town’s living room (think Central Perk vibes for all of you Friends fans out there). Owner Laura fills the walls with artwork from local artists, giving the café a creative, ever-changing charm. The chalkboard menu proudly declares the “Best Egg Sandwich in Town,” and it truly lives up to the claim. Pair it with one of their homemade baked goods and a seasonally inspired specialty coffee drink (the names are as fun as the flavors), and you’ve got the perfect Chesterton breakfast stop before exploring the Indiana Dunes.

    Wagner’s Ribs – A Local Chesterton Staple

    If you ask locals for the best barbecue in Chesterton, Indiana, most will point you straight to Wagner’s Ribs. Their ribs are famous for being tender, smoky, and fall-off-the-bone delicious. The atmosphere is casual and unpretentious, but there’s one thing to note: Wagner’s is 21+ only, so plan to leave the kids at home for this one.

    Root & Bone – Comfort Food with Style

    Southern comfort food meets Instagram-worthy decor at Root & Bone. Their fried chicken and savory grits are hands-down some of the best in the region. Beyond the menu, the space is playfully decorated with things like saucers and cutting boards on the walls and bathrooms labeled in vintage typewriter font. If you’re looking for a unique, memorable place to eat near the Dunes, Root & Bone is it.

    Lucrezia Café – Cozy Italian in Chesterton

    Nestled inside a historic old house, Lucrezia is one of the most popular restaurants in Chesterton. This Italian café has a warm, cozy vibe and is the perfect place for a romantic dinner or gathering with friends. Their martinis are some of the best in town, and the menu features Italian classics with a local twist.

    Running Vines Winery – Wine & Pizza in Downtown Chesterton

    Located right in downtown Chesterton at the corner of Calumet and Broadway, Running Vines is a wine lover’s dream. They’re known for their pizza of the month, seasonal drinks, flights, & even creative mocktail options, making it a fun spot whether you drink wine or not. The space is always decorated beautifully for the season, which makes every visit feel festive.

    Octave Grill – Eclectic Burgers Near the Dunes

    If eclectic burgers are your thing, Octave Grill is a must-visit. They use tall grass beef and build out a menu of inventive burger combinations that will leave you planning your next trip back. What makes Octave especially memorable is its quirky, vintage vibe of mismatched plates, unique salt and pepper shakers at each table, and an overall atmosphere that feels playful and one-of-a-kind.

    Third Coast Spice Café – Breakfast & Lunch Favorite

    Breakfast and lunch lovers, take note: Third Coast Spice Café is legendary. Nearly everything is locally sourced, organic, and often cooked in ghee, which gives their dishes an unforgettable richness. The flavors here are bold and thoughtful & nothing on the menu feels ordinary. Add in a staff that’s consistently kind and attentive, and you’ve got a spot that many consider the best breakfast in Chesterton, Indiana.

    Lemon Tree Mediterranean Grill – Casual & Flavorful

    If you’re craving Mediterranean flavors, Lemon Tree is a fun, fast-casual option with big personality. Built in a former Subway sandwich shop, the layout lets you pick your base, protein (like chicken or steak shawarma), and toppings. Don’t skip the house-made sauces…the spicy yogurt is a fan favorite. It’s the sister restaurant to Third Coast Spice Café and is open for lunch and early dinner.

    Things to consider for your Brincka Cross Gardens Session…

    There are a few things to know about the property so you can plan to the best of your ability for your photo session.

    Brincka has come a long way with their parking game. There used to be only a couple of spots by where the house on the property resides, but now there is a whole gravel parking area just to the west of the property. You can park there and take the wood to gravel trail into the main part of the property now unless you were lucky enough to grab the slots near the house. I usually tell clients to meet me by the house, so with either parking area you’ll find your way eventually. 🙂

    A second topic to think about is the bathroom situation. There is a porta potty on the property that honestly always seems pretty kept up when I have had to use it, but it’s definitely not ideal for outfit switches for say a senior session. With that said, just make sure you are prepared to perhaps change in the car. If you are there for a session that doesn’t require any changes then you are good to go.

    Another thing to consider is bringing a blanket for your session. Even if it’s not something you will actually see in the photo, it’s nice to have for posing that may require you to lay or sit in spots that could be on the muddy side (which is a common occurance at Brincka Cross). The property is so shaded that sometimes even a day and a half after a rain, there are spots that hold the moisture in. Trust me when I say, it’s best to be prepared!

    A final few tips for your Brincka Cross Gardens Session & preparing for the season accordingly…

    One of the final, but IMPORTANT things I want to mention to do upon entering the park is to make sure you have bug spray on hand. I cannot stress this enough. I always, always, always come armed when I have a summer session because the few times I didn’t or I thought “Oh it’s early in the season, it will be fine.”, it wasn’t! After a few times of getting bit up I learned my lesson. And honestly, if it’s warm out…even if the mosquitos aren’t biting, it doesn’t mean there won’t be ticks lurking around… Better safe than sorry, ya dig?

    Don’t get me wrong. You’ll still get gorgeous photos like my clients below, but we paid the price in mosquito bites for this particular session. LOL!

    The last thing I would probably take the time to say is if you are on the trails just to do your due diligence and check for poison oak or ivy along the pathways. I will say the park does an AMAZING job at keeping things groomed, but if you have kid’s that explore a little off the beaten path there is no guarantee they won’t find some. As a precaution, throw them in a soapy bath by the evening after your session and they should be in the clear.
